What is Franklin Covey's united states canada — non-current assets?
Franklin Covey (FC) reported united states canada — non-current assets of $45.68M in Q2 2025.
How has Franklin Covey's united states canada — non-current assets changed year-over-year?
Franklin Covey's united states canada — non-current assets increased by 60.0% year-over-year, from $28.55M to $45.68M.
What does united states canada — non-current assets mean?
This metric represents the total value of long-term assets, such as property, equipment, intangible assets, and goodwill, specifically attributed to the United States and Canada geographic segment. It reflects the capital investment and long-term resource base required to support the company's training and consulting operations within this primary market. Monitoring this balance helps investors assess the scale of infrastructure and the potential for future depreciation or amortization impacts on regional profitability.
